Open Gate
Kuami Eugene
Kuami Eugene's "Open Gate" moves with a buoyant, communal energy — the production stacks percussion layers with a live, organic feel, like something recorded in a room where people are actually present and moving. Guitar tones are bright and clean, melodic phrases circling back with the insistence of a refrain you would clap along to. There is a joyful urgency in the arrangement, synths adding shimmer without overwhelming the rootedness of the groove. Kuami Eugene's vocals are distinctively textured — a slight rasp in the mid-register that gives his singing an earthy authenticity, and he uses call-and-response phrasing that feels drawn from Ghanaian highlife tradition, updated without being sanitized. The song carries a spirit of breakthrough and welcome — the sense of doors opening, of favor arriving, of celebration that feels earned rather than arbitrary. It sits in a tradition of West African music that treats joy as a spiritual act, not a trivial one. Culturally, Kuami Eugene has been central to the contemporary highlife revival, fusing modern Afrobeats production with melodic and structural sensibilities rooted in older Ghanaian forms. This is the kind of song that plays best when people are gathered — a graduation party, a homecoming, the kind of afternoon where a yard fills with people who are genuinely glad to be in the same place together.
